Gene conversion shapes linear mitochondrial genome architecture.
Genome biology and evolution - 1 Jan 2013
Smith David Roy, Keeling Patrick J
Abstract excerpt
Recently, it was shown that gene conversion between the ends of linear mitochondrial chromosomes can cause telomere expansion and the duplication of subtelomeric loci. However, it is not yet known how widespread this phenomenon is and how significantly it has impacted organelle genome architecture.
